Microsoft's Macintosh Business Unit released Messenger for Mac 5.1, an update to Messenger for Mac 5 which was released on August 2005.

Fixes include file transfers to users outside of a user’s firewall, Live Communications Server usage, messages being sent to the appropriate location. For IT administrators, the update will provide more control over saving chats at an organizational level.

I'm sure everyone heard about this one too, being the best MSN app for Mac yet: http://amsn.sourceforge.net/

it's not Mac-native, it's TCL/CK -- i.e. some things won't work properly, like scroll bars.

Quote:
aMSN is a free open source MSN Messenger clone, with features such as:

Display pictures
Custom emoticons
Multi-language support (around 40 languages currently supported)
Webcam support
Sign in to more than one account at once
Full-speed File transfers
Group support
Normal, and animated emoticons with sounds
Chat logs
Timestamping
Event alarms
Conferencing support
Tabbed chat windows
